Some members of Occupy Boston chose to pack their belongings in advance of the midnight evacuation deadline set by Mayor Menino, while others decided to stay.

Occupy Boston Faces Eviction
Only a few hours before midnight on Thursday, the deadline set by Boston Mayor Thomas M. Menino to vacate Dewey Square Park, Occupy Boston protestors express their intention to continue the movement, even if the occupation ends.
